Water industry leaders announced that they have joined forces in the establishment of SWAN, the Smart Water Networks Forum, a global industry alliance promoting the use of data technologies in water networks to make them smarter, more efficient and more sustainable.
Smart water networks leverage data and information technology for an improved, streamlined and more efficient operation of water utility distribution networks. With the increased instrumentation and telemetry of water networks, a new layer of smart data applications has become possible. Smart water network solutions improve the efficiency, longevity and reliability of the underlying physical water network by better measuring, collecting, analyzing and acting upon a wide range of events.
The founding members of the SWAN forum are Derceto, Echologics (a division of Mueller Water), i2O Water, TaKaDu, Telvent and Schneider Electric. Vienna Waterworks and other utilities will join the advisory committee.
The SWAN forum will be holding its inaugural conference, SWAN 2011, on May 17 and 18 in Paris at the Schneider Electric Headquarters. During this two-day conference, leaders and members in the smart water space will discuss the opportunities, challenges and next steps in bringing the vision of smart water to fruition, highlighting the state of smart water networks today and in the coming years, showcasing technologies and discussing real world utility best practices.
